The Benefits of Working Out Your Legs
When it comes to working out, men often overlook leg day. But don’t do it! Leg day is important for many reasons, not the least of which is that it will help you build a better body in the long run. Let’s take a look at why leg day should be an integral part of any man’s workout routine.

The True Benefits of Leg Day
Working out your legs helps you build strong legs, but it also helps with balance and coordination. This is especially true when exercises include compound movements such as squats and lunges, which require you to use multiple muscle groups at once. Working your legs also helps with posture and can aid in preventing back pain.

Leg exercises like squats and deadlifts are great for building core strength since they engage the ab muscles to help stabilize the spine during movement. Squats also increase hip mobility, which can improve performance in sports like running and jumping. Other benefits include improved circulation (due to increased blood flow) and increased testosterone levels (which can improve overall energy).

In addition to all these physical benefits, there are psychological benefits to exercising your legs as well. After a good leg workout, endorphins are released—the “feel-good” hormones that can reduce stress levels and make you feel happier overall. Plus, completing a challenging set of reps gives you a sense of accomplishment that will help keep you motivated for other workouts throughout the week.
